Gombe
Gombe mixes business with pleasure as Kinshasa's upscale riverfront district. The Congo River provides a scenic backdrop for strolls past embassies and gleaming office towers. Art lovers can explore the Académie des Beaux-Arts, while shoppers head to Kin Plaza Mall for high-end retail therapy. The Kinshasa Zoo and National Museum offer cultural breaks between business meetings. Dining options range from French to Lebanese cuisine in hotel restaurants and riverside terraces. Most visitors stay in luxury hotels with pools and security features. Taxis and ride-sharing apps are the main transportation options, though the district's core is walkable for those who don't mind the tropical heat.
Limete
Limete buzzes with the energy of Kinshasa's commercial heartbeat. Business travelers appreciate the central location and proximity to corporate offices, while curious tourists can glimpse authentic Congolese urban life. The Pentecost Martyrs Stadium draws sports fans, and you're just a quick trip from the People's Palace and Kinshasa Zoo. Local eateries serve delicious Congolese staples like fufu and grilled fish alongside street food vendors with affordable options. Business hotels and guesthouses provide comfortable, functional accommodations. Getting around is simple with frequent bus routes and shared taxis connecting you to Kinshasa's main attractions.

Ngaliema
Ngaliema brings diplomatic flair to Kinshasa with its leafy boulevards and upscale riverside scene. Embassy compounds hide behind manicured hedges while Congo River terraces offer stunning sunset views over dinner. The neighborhood's exclusive shopping centers showcase quality Congolese crafts and traditional masks for those seeking authentic souvenirs. Getting around requires taxis since attractions are spread out, but the tree-lined streets are perfect for strolling within gated areas. Luxury hotels and boutique guesthouses offer pools and concierge services, creating a peaceful retreat from Kinshasa's busier districts.
Bandalungwa
Experience authentic Kinshasa life in Bandalungwa, where colorful concrete homes with metal roofs line dusty streets filled with daily rhythms. This residential commune invites you into the heart of Congolese culture through lively community gatherings and local music scenes. The neighborhood offers a genuine window into Kinshasa away from tourist crowds. Local eateries serve delicious Congolese staples like fufu and grilled fish at budget-friendly prices. Shared taxis and buses connect to central attractions like People's Palace and Académie des Beaux-Arts. Small guesthouses and family-run lodges provide affordable accommodation with high host interaction.
